Nordeoxycholic acid is a metabolite of the bile acid norcholic acid and a 23-carbon derivative of deoxycholic acid .1 Levels of nordeoxycholic acid are decreased in the liver of rats in a high-fat diet model of non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) and serum levels are lower in men compared with women.2,3 Nordeoxycholic acid has commonly been used as an internal standard for the quantification of bile acids in various sample types by GC- and LC-MS.4,5
